Легенда:
новое сообщение
закрытая нитка
новое сообщение
в закрытой нитке
старое сообщение
|
- Напоминаю, что масса вопросов по функционированию форума снимается после прочтения его описания.
- Новичкам также крайне полезно ознакомиться с данным документом.
|
сложно сказать наверняка. попробуй default-charset=cp1251 12.12.03 19:54 Число просмотров: 1516
Автор: Eugene Статус: Незарегистрированный пользователь
|
и вообще - такие проблемы со словами на латинице тоже возникают?
|
<sysadmin>
|
Полнотекстовые индексы в mysql 11.12.03 21:17
Автор: dron <Ivanov Andrey> Статус: Member
|
Сделал полнотекстовый индекс по 8-ми столбцам в большой таблице (порядка 400 мегов данных). И теперь по запросу вылетают не только строки содержащие подстроку, указанную в запросе, но и строки содержащие похожую подстроку... Т.е. на select * where match (col1,col2,col3,col4,col5,col6,col7,col8) against ('парус'); вылетают предложения содержащие слова 'парус', 'марус', 'галларус', или select * where match (col1,col2,col3,col4,col5,col6,col7,col8) against ('никс');
кроме никса, вылетают 'микс' и т.д. Версия mysql 3.2*, то есть in boolean mode - не прокатывает.
Не подскажите в чем могет быть дело?? Спасибо!
|
|
сложно сказать наверняка. попробуй default-charset=cp1251 12.12.03 19:54
Автор: Eugene Статус: Незарегистрированный пользователь
|
и вообще - такие проблемы со словами на латинице тоже возникают?
|
| |
а там их и нет -((, тока русские, попробую добавить штучек... 13.12.03 16:50
Автор: dron <Ivanov Andrey> Статус: Member
|
> и вообще - такие проблемы со словами на латинице тоже > возникают? а там их и нет -((, тока русские, попробую добавить штучек 10-20... и посмотреть
а default-charset=cp1251 куды вставлять в php скрипт??, или как-то в sql запросе указывать??.
|
|
|